See my post above Speedz, Jean Claude Biver was the European Sales and Marketing Director for Audemars Piguet, he started at Blancpain, rejuvenated the brand, when BP were bought out he migrated to Omega, then AP, subsequently Carlo Croco poached him over to rejuvenate Hublot, he's principally a sales and marketing guy, with emphasis on product placement, targeting the rich and famous and allying them to whichever brand he's favouring with his patronage, restricting supply to create market fever and hunger. He stole Gerald Genta's original Royal Oak design, modified it a tad here and there and went on the rampage with his mission statement for Hublot, "the fusion of tradition and future.", he created Blancpain's brand identity also by mission statement"Since 1735 there has never been a quartz Blancpain watch. And there never will be."!
